POLICE have released an efit after thieves stole at least £1,000 from a woman's bank account.
The woman, aged in her 60s, was in her car outside Sainsbury’s in White Hart Lane, Chelmsford, when a man and a woman approached and asked for directions.
She opened the passenger side window and one of the suspects leant in, claimed they were lost and showed her a map.
They then removed her bank cards from her handbag on the passenger seat which was covered by the map.
The incident happened at 2.30pm on Sunday, July 12.
A four figure sum of cash was later removed from the victim's bank accounts.
Anyone who recognises the man depicted in the efit is asked to contact officers at Chelmsford Police Station on 101 or contact Crimestoppers anonymously on 0800 555 111 or via www.crimestoppers-uk.org.
